Csináltunk valakinek egy weboldalt, de a megrendelő nem
akar fizetni. Hogy tudnánk az oldalt letiltani?
módosítsad az oldalt, hogy figyelje az aktuális dátumot és ha túllépte akkor egy fehér háttérre írja ki amit mondtál. majd lecseréled erre az "új" oldalra, ami látszólag nem is különbözik.
ezt az időpontot meg 3hétmúlvára állítod (vagy egy viszonylag távolabbi időpontra) és reménykedsz hogy nem 3 héttel ezelőtti mentésből állítja vissza a szolgáltató az oldalt. így akárhányszor visszaállítja mindig az fog megjelenni amit akartál.
2011. ápr. 6. 21:24
Hasznos számodra ez a válasz?
12/24 A kérdező kommentje:
Utolsónak írnám, először is köszi a válaszodat, másodszor: arra gondolsz, hogy leszedni az oldalon ami fel van rakva, azt elmenteni (tehát a semmit) és várni, hogy azt mentse majd el a központi szerver, és egy idő után majd az lesz a biztonsági mentés? Egyre gondolunk? Mert én is valami ilyesmire jutottam. Csak írtál valami dátum átállításról ezt kifejtenéd?Vagyis egyre gondolunk? tehát leszedni ami fent van, üres oldalakat elmenteni, vagyis szöveggel, hogy nemfizetés ...stb, és várni, hogy a szerver az üres oldalakat mentse el? És ha telefonálnak hogy állítsa vissza a szolgáltató akkor neki is az üres oldala lesz meg? Vajon a régi nem lesz meg neki? mert ha kell ezt naponta megcsinálom. bocsi, hogy kicsit bonyolult vagyok, remélem egyre gondolunk.
miután ha észre veszi a "tulaj", hogy elrontottad az oldalát, akkor szól a tárhelyszolgáltatónak, hogy állítsa vissza. nade a szolgáltató egy (ezt nem tudom pontosan csak egy tipp) 1-2 héttel ezelőtti állapotot állít vissza. nah de ha te belerakod a kódba, hogy egy bizonyos időpont után (mondjuk 2 hét múlva) állítódjon át a "tiltakozó oldaladra", akkor ugyan ezt a "hackelt" oldalt fogja vissza állítani 2 hét múlva a tárhelyszolgáltató is neki, tehát semmit nem ér vele. viszont ezen 2 hétig rendesen, feltűnés nélkül fog neki menni az oldal és szépen a szerver backupjába beleíródik.
2011. ápr. 7. 19:34
Hasznos számodra ez a válasz?
14/24 A kérdező kommentje:
És most már csak aza kérdésem lenne az utolsó kommentelőnek, hogy tudnál e ebben segíteni, hogy kell ezt megcsinálni????
php ismeretem az 0.
de annyit tudok, hogy van függvény ami lekérdezi az aktuális dátumot és van benne if elágazás.
ezt a kettőt kombinálod és kész.
2011. ápr. 7. 20:23
Hasznos számodra ez a válasz?
Szerintem egyszerűen megnézed mikor lett módosítva a fájl ( mert ha vissza lett állítva akkor módosul a módosítás dátuma frissebbre)
php
<?php
$time = 10048489 //most perpill netom mennyi az aktuális idő de nézd meg time() függvénnyeel és mondjuk vonjál ki belőle 60*60*24*2, ami visszaadja az 5 nappal ezelőtti time értékét
if(filemtime('index.html')>$time){//Akkor 5 napnál korábban volt visszaállítva a fájl
}
else{//5 napnál régebbi a fájl
}
?>
Remélem tudsz vele valamit kezdeni :)
2011. ápr. 7. 22:05
Hasznos számodra ez a válasz?
Előző vagyok bocs : 60*60*24*5 <- ez az 5 nappal ezelőtti d egondolom rájöttél :D
2011. ápr. 7. 22:06
Hasznos számodra ez a válasz?
18/24 A kérdező kommentje:
Köszönöm mindenkinek a válaszokat, úgy látszik picit lassúak voltunk (én és a férjem), mert sajnos a belépési kódokat persze hogy megváltoztatta :(
2011. ápr. 8. 15:21
Hasznos számodra ez a válasz?
20/24 A kérdező kommentje:
Ezt hogy érted? Van még valami ötlet a tarsolyodban?
Kapcsolódó kérdések: